Margaret “Margie” Theresa Feist was born February 10, 1931 to Frank and Theresa (Swiegler) Feist in Ridgeview, SD. She grew up in Ellendale, ND where she graduated from Ellendale High School.
Margie was united in marriage to Harold J. Schlepp in Ellendale on December 1, 1949. Their union was blessed with three children: Yvonne, Sandra, and John. Margie and Harold lived in Aberdeen, SD until 1960, where she worked for “The Flame” and “Mels” Café as a waitress and cook. She continued in the restaurant business upon their move to Tyndall, SD, where she owned her own café called “Red’s”. In 1967, They moved to Freeborn, MN. Margie continued her energetic nature by working with the physical and mentally disabled. She eventually retired in Waseca, MN. Margie finished her circle of life in Aberdeen.
Margaret loved to go to second hand stores and garage sales. She was always looking for a good deal. Her red hair and feisty personality made it easy to know when she was around.
She never let you leave her house without being told “God go with you”.
